Over the last few years, I’ve seen more and more people pull out “plastic” to pay for everything they need — from gas to groceries to fast food.

Why not? When all it takes is a quick swipe of the card through a little electronic box and a signature then, everything’s okay. You go home happy, content, and almost worry-free. On the other hand, the convenience of using credit cards can lead to a false feeling of financial security. And this realization will strike you as soon as the bills arrive.

I used to get my credit card bills and month after month, I would be shocked at how much we had spent. I’d say, “that can’t be right” but every month I’d add up all the charges and it would be right.

So, then I’d look at each item and each item was justifiable. Every one had been legitimate at the time of purchase. But, they did add up so quickly.
